Vapier's abilities in the game are a wild mix of elemental chaos and strategic finesse! They’ve got this signature move called 'Steam Surge,' where they manipulate water and fire to create scalding mist that damages opponents over time. It’s not just about raw power, though—their 'Tidal Dodge' lets them phase through attacks by dissolving into water vapor, which is clutch for evading heavy hits.
What’s really cool is how their passive, 'Boiling Point,' ramps up their damage the longer they stay in battle, like a pressure cooker ready to explode. I love pairing them with terrain-altering teammates to trap enemies in their steam zones. They’re not the tankiest character, but their hit-and-run playstyle feels so satisfying when you pull off a perfect combo.
Vapier’s kit is all about control and disruption. Their primary ability, 'Scalding Jet,' shoots a high-pressure stream of hot water that knocks back enemies and applies a burn effect. Then there’s 'Vapor Cloak,' which turns them semi-invisible in humid environments—super useful for ambushes or escaping sticky situations.
Their ultimate, 'Typhoon’s Wrath,' summons a massive whirlpool of steam that sucks in nearby foes and deals continuous damage. It’s borderline OP in tight maps. What I appreciate is how their design leans into the 'elemental trickster' vibe—more about outsmarting opponents than brute force.
Playing as Vapier feels like orchestrating a steamy ballet of destruction. Their basic attacks infuse water with heat, causing delayed burst damage that catches opponents off guard. One underrated skill is 'Condensate,' which leaves temporary pools of boiling water on the ground—perfect for zoning.
Their mobility is insane too; 'Flash Evaporate' lets them teleport short distances by transforming into mist, though it’s got a cooldown that punishes spamming. I’ve lost count of how many times I’ve turned the tide in team fights by using their ultimate at the right moment. They’re a high-risk, high-reward pick that rewards creativity.
Vapier’s powers revolve around thermal manipulation—think of them as a walking sauna with a vendetta. Their 'Steam Bind' ability wraps enemies in heated vapor, slowing them while dealing tick damage. It synergizes weirdly well with ice-based teammates, since the rapid temperature shift can shatter foes.
They also have a quirky passive called 'Humidity Boost,' which strengthens their spells near water sources. I once won a match by luring opponents into a rainy map zone and unleashing hell. Not the easiest to master, but damn, they’re fun when you get the rhythm.
